China has long been recognized as a global leader in the field of technology and innovation. One of the areas where China has made significant strides is in the realm of Bitcoin mining. As the world's largest producer of Bitcoin, China plays a crucial role in the global cryptocurrency ecosystem. In this article, we will delve into the current state of Bitcoin mining in China, the challenges it faces, and the opportunities it presents.
China on Bitcoin Mining: A Brief Overview
Bitcoin mining is the process by which new bitcoins are entered into circulation and is also a critical component of the maintenance and development of the blockchain ledger. Miners use powerful computers to solve complex mathematical problems, and in return, they are rewarded with newly created bitcoins. China has become a dominant player in this industry, with a significant portion of the global Bitcoin mining capacity located within its borders.
China on Bitcoin Mining: The Growth Story
The rise of Bitcoin mining in China can be attributed to several factors. Firstly, China has a robust infrastructure, including a stable electricity supply and a large pool of skilled workers. Secondly, the cost of electricity in China is relatively low compared to other countries, making it an attractive destination for miners. Lastly, the Chinese government's initial indifference towards cryptocurrencies allowed the industry to flourish without excessive regulation.
Over the years, China has become the epicenter of Bitcoin mining, with several mining pools, such as BTC.com and F2Pool, dominating the market. These pools have the computational power to solve a significant number of mathematical problems, which in turn, ensures the security and stability of the Bitcoin network.
China on Bitcoin Mining: Challenges and Concerns
Despite the growth of Bitcoin mining in China, the industry faces several challenges and concerns. One of the primary concerns is the environmental impact of Bitcoin mining. The process requires a substantial amount of electricity, which, in turn, leads to increased carbon emissions. As China is committed to reducing its carbon footprint, the government has started to crack down on Bitcoin mining activities in certain regions, particularly in Inner Mongolia and Sichuan.
Another challenge is the regulatory environment. While the Chinese government has not banned cryptocurrencies outright, it has implemented strict regulations on exchanges and trading platforms. This has led to a decrease in the number of Bitcoin exchanges in China, making it more difficult for miners to sell their bitcoins.
